HOPE KUCHING FAMILY DAY

 

Hope Family Day was held on November 7 at Stampark Recreation Park, Kuching. More than 700 members and children participated in the event. It started off with morning exercise led by a group of energetic Uni group students. Then the games started at 9am, with Pastor Denis Lu officiating the event. All participants were divided into 10 teams. Each team had its theme colour where all members wore attire that matched that colour.

The cheer of each team was creative, and some were really mind blowing! All 10 teams competed in 5 different games over a 2 hour duration. Each game required teamwork, creativity and energy from every team. At the end of the games, prizes were given away to the winners. Water baptism followed after that. A total of 37 people underwent water baptism, signifying their faith in Jesus Christ. The event ended with a picnic where each team brought their own food and shared with other teams, putting Christ's love in practice.

Hope Family Day was truly an event that has pulled all Hope members together, not so much in winning the games, but to foster relationships with each other. This can be seen as one of the powerful ways to strengthen God's people.
